World Trade Center Baltimore is a good place to start your sales job search in Maryland. Headquarters for shipping lines and the Maryland Port Administration, this is where the big business takes place: Baltimore's port ranks 9th for total dollar value of cargo and 13th for cargo tonnage in the U.S. Look also at tourism, which is a major component of the economy, with key sites like the Inner Harbor, the National Aquarium and a plethora of historic warships.
